Former President Donald Trump has repeatedly dismissed the Epstein files as a hoax, attributing calls for their release to a Democratic attempt to distract public attention. Trump characterized the entire Epstein case as "total bullshit" and a diversionary tactic orchestrated by Democrats. During a recent press conference, he denied authoring a risqué letter published by The Wall Street Journal that was found in Jeffrey Epstein's 50th birthday album from 2003. Observers have noted that Trump's law-and-order rhetoric appears aimed at shifting focus away from both the Epstein case and the impact of recent tariffs.
